Despite being a cheaper, white-room, 'fast-food' chinese' places, the quality rivals the more expensive cuisine in this city. I randomly chose it after moving here a year ago and was stunned. The very best fried rice I have ever tasted (no salt or seasoning required), very tasty eggrolls, and large portions on the dinner menus. The service is swift and polite, and they give you time to finish your soup before bringing out your meal. After visiting a few times, they already know what I order and how I like it prepared. Alas, the lunch special gives you not enough for leftovers, but enough so that you feel a little too full after finishing. Regardless, this is easily my favorite chinese restaurant in the city, far superior to the more glamourous PF CHangs or Kung Pow. It's a diamond in the rough and I kept reccomend it enough.
Pros: shockingly tasty, properly prepared, fair prices
Cons: $10 min for delivery
